Anathece smithii é uma cianobactéria colonial que forma pequenas colônias irregularmente arredondadas embebidas em mucilagem em ambientes de água doce. Habita corpos de água doce eutróficos a mesotróficos, incluindo lagos e lagoas em regiões temperadas. Este procarioto fotossintético contribui para as comunidades de fitoplâncton e para o ciclo do nitrogênio em ecossistemas de água doce.
